Shattered Promises: A Second Change at Love
Barbara and her sister Linda had always been at odds, but their rivalry reached a new level of intensity when a DNA test revealed shocking revelations about the paternity of their sons. The test showed that Barbara's son Lawson was actually the biological child of ex-husband Casey, while Linda's son Irvin was not the son of Casey as she claimed. After the DNA test revelation, Casey pleaded to Barbara to forgive him, accusing Linda of tricking him to marry her all for her selfish gain for the family inheritance. After long consideration Barbara accepted him back
This discovery set off a bitter feud over the family's substantial inheritance. Linda, desperate to secure her share, hatched a sinister plan to eliminate her sister. One morning, as Barbara was driving to work, she was ambushed by Linda's hired hitmen. They forced her out of her car and shot her , leaving her bleeding on the side of the road.
Miraculously, passing Good Samaritan witnessed the attack and rushed Barbara to hospital. Doctors worked frantically to save her life, extracting three of the bullets, but one remained lodged precariously near her ribs. The trauma of the assault, combined with the severe head injury she sustained in the fall, sent Barbara into a coma.
While Barbara fought for her life, Linda seized the opportunity to manipulate the inheritance, exploiting her sister's incapacitation to claim the lion's share for herself. Barbara's devoted husband Casey remained by her bedside, praying for her recovery.
After years in the coma, Barbara miraculously regained consciousness. Filled with a renewed determination, she set out to reclaim what was rightfully hers, engaging in a fierce legal battle against her conniving sister. The sisters' conflict escalated, with both of them willing to go to extreme lengths to secure the family's wealth and legacy.
